Just in case anyone has any suggestions to help me before I order some injectors.
So the morning of the AGM the car started up missing on the front two cylinders which were previously running fine.
First cleaned the injector plugs, no joy. Ive swapped coils and the problem persisted, checked spark and the spark is strong, pulled the plugs and they are dry and white leading me to believe it has indeed got no fuel.
So I checked the resistance of the injectors and they are within spec at 12-13.8 ohms. Voltage also checks out at 12.8V (early style injectors btw).
So although they are within spec the cylinder still has no fuel in it so may just put some new injectors in (hopefully before Simply Jap).
Any other suggestions?
